深入解析“Shopex爬虫”:技术原理、应用场景与风险应对
一、Shopex爬虫技术原理
“Shopex爬虫”本质上是一种网络爬虫技术,它的核心功能在于自动化地从目标网站抓取所需数据。这种技术主要基于网络请求与响应的原理来实现。当爬虫程序向目标网站发起请求时,会模拟出类似于真实用户浏览网页的行为,从而获取网站返回的数据。这些数据往往包括了商品信息、价格、销量等关键内容,对于后续的数据分析、挖掘乃至商业决策都具有重要意义。
在具体实现上,“Shopex爬虫”通常会结合多种技术手段,如IP轮询、请求头伪装、Cookie处理等,以应对可能遇到的各种反爬机制。同时,为了保证数据抓取的效率和准确性,它还会进行定时任务设置、数据清洗以及异常处理等操作。这些复杂而精细的技术环节共同构成了“Shopex爬虫”的强大功能。
二、Shopex爬虫的应用场景
1. 电商数据分析:在电商领域,通过“Shopex爬虫”抓取各大电商平台的商品信息、价格变动等数据,有助于商家及时了解市场动态,调整经营策略。同时,这些数据还可以用于竞品分析,为商家提供宝贵的市场情报。
2. 价格监测与比价系统:利用爬虫技术,可以实时监测系统内商品的价格变动,一旦发现价格异常或竞争优势减弱,即可迅速作出反应。此外,比价系统通过爬虫抓取的数据,能为消费者提供更全面的购物选择,提升用户体验。
3. 网络营销与广告投放:通过对爬虫抓取的数据进行深入分析,可以精准定位用户需求和市场趋势,从而制定更有效的营销策略。同时,这些数据还能为广告投放提供精细化的支撑,提高广告效果和转化率。
三、Shopex爬虫的风险与应对措施
虽然“Shopex爬虫”在数据获取方面展现出了强大的能力,但随之而来的风险也不容忽视。首先,未经授权的数据抓取可能涉嫌侵犯他人隐私权或知识产权,一旦引发纠纷,将面临严重的法律风险。其次,过度的爬虫活动可能会对目标网站造成性能压力甚至崩溃,这不仅损害了网站的正常运营,也可能导致爬虫自身被屏蔽或封禁。
为了有效应对这些风险,以下措施值得借鉴:
1. 遵守法律法规:在进行数据爬取前,务必确保已经获得了相关权限或许可,避免触犯法律红线。同时,定期对爬虫程序进行合规性审查也是必不可少的环节。
2. 优化爬虫策略:通过合理设置爬虫的请求频率、数据量等参数,减少对目标网站的压力。同时,利用技术手段如IP代理、请求头随机化等提升爬虫的隐匿性,降低被封禁的风险。
3. 加强数据安全防护:对抓取到的数据进行严格的加密存储和传输,确保数据的安全性。同时,建立完善的数据使用和管理规范,防止数据泄露或被滥用。
四、结语
“Shopex爬虫”作为一种强大的数据获取工具,在多个领域都有着广泛的应用前景。然而,在享受其带来的便利与效益的同时,我们也应时刻警惕其中潜在的风险。只有在合法合规、安全可控的前提下,我们才能充分发挥“Shopex爬虫”的价值,助力企业在激烈的市场竞争中脱颖而出。